The group of Yukio Fujiki, a specially appointed professor at the Institute of Biodefense Medicine, Kyushu University, succeeded in identifying the novel protein DYNAMO1 that regulates the proliferation of mitochondria and peroxisomes for the first time in the world.

 The earth has been covered with high-concentration oxygen for about 23 billion years.Mitochondria use this oxygen to produce the energy essential for our vital activities.On the other hand, peroxisomes detoxify the highly toxic (active oxygen) generated during energy production.Since abnormal proliferation of mitochondria and peroxisomes causes neurological diseases such as Parkinson's disease, elucidation of the division mechanism is an important issue in the fields of life science including medicine.

 So far, the research team has been the first in the world to clarify the existence of molecular devices involved in the division of mitochondria and peroxisomes.It has been found that the membrane is divided by the contraction of the ring-shaped structure of this device, but the details of the constituent substances and the contraction mechanism of the device were unknown.

 Therefore, this time, the group took this device out of the cell, proceeded with mass spectrometry and cell structural biology analysis, succeeded in identifying the novel dividing protein DYNAMO1, and found that DYNAMO1 produces the energy required for the contraction of the device. discovered.It is suggested that the energy produced by DYNAMO1 operates the division device in the division of organelles in the same way that engines such as automobiles produce energy from petroleum.

 This result is a discovery that leads to the elucidation of the basic principle of eukaryotic cells.

Paper information:[Nature Communications] Onsite GTP fuelling via DYNAMO1 drives division of mitochondria and peroxisomes
